On Sunday 19th January 2014 five members of Aycliffe Running Club braved the rain for the Brass Monkey Half Marathon at York. The race, which is hosted by York Knavesmire Harriers, had to be cancelled last year due to snow and, although no snow this year, conditions were very wet.
However, the weather did not dampen the spirits of the 1500 competitors. The race was mostly flat and on public roads.  It headed southwards through Bishopthorpe, Acaster Selby, Appleton Roebuck and back through Bishopthorpe to finish behind the racecourse grandstands. First to finish for Aycliffe was Graham Atkins 1:33:06, followed by Sandra Collins 1:47:44, Trish Kay 1:48:24, John Young 1:50:36, and Dave Mackenzie 2:04:36
On the same day at the Stockton Winter 5k Trail Series at Cowpen Bewley.   Peter Smith and Kevin Greenall represented Aycliffe Running Club.  It was reported as being a mud bath with competitors slipping and sliding but most runners seemed to enjoy the mud and some described it as being ‘a great character building experience’.
Peter Smith completed the course in 19th position and 1st M50 23:06 and Kevin Greenall 53rd in 26:39. Visit www.ayclifferunningclub.org.uk for details about the club and their training sessions.
